I'm sorry to say that I met layerindex' loaddata problems yesterday and
today,
I still didn't find the root cause. Have you tried dumpdata and loaddata
recently, please ?
What I did was:
$ python3 manage.py dumpdata --settings settings --exclude=contenttypes
--exclude=auth.Permission -- exclude=corsheaders >dumped.json
On another environment:
Setup database to sqlite3 in settings.py.
$ python3 manage.py loaddata --settings settings dumped.json
The first problem I got was:
[snip]
File
"/buildarea1/lyang1/layerindex-web/.venv/lib/python3.5/site-packages/reversion/revisions.py",
line 410, in _assert_registered
model=model,
reversion.errors.RegistrationError: Problem installing fixture
'/buildarea1/lyang1/layerindex-web/dumped.json': <class
'layerindex.models.Distro'> has not been registered with django-reversion
[snip]
I think it is because we didn't use @reversion.register() for the class, so I
added them to layerindex/models.py, then I got other errors:
[snip]
File
"/buildarea1/lyang1/layerindex-web/.venv/lib/python3.5/site-packages/reversion/models.py",
line 272, in _local_field_dict
field_dict[field.attname] = getattr(obj, field.attname)
AttributeError: Problem installing fixture
'/buildarea1/lyang1/layerindex-web/dumped.json': 'Branch' object has no
attribute 'layerbranch_id'
Hmm, that's odd. Branch shouldn't have layerbranch_id, it's the other way
around -
LayerBranch has a branch_id.
I'm not sure what's wrong atm, need more investigations.
I need loaddata on my localhost to do development testing, so I can't start
work on update.py until I fix the loaddata problem.
I have used loaddata and dumpdata here (a couple of times) but not recently.
I did not experience these issues before though. However these don't seem like
issues that would have started as a result of this patchset (or indeed recent
changes, other than perhaps an upgrade of django-reversion), have you been
using loaddata/dumpdata prior to this?
dumpdata/loaddata worked well before March, Konrad (in CC) worked it around by:
dumpdata --exclude=corsheaders --exclude=reversion.version
--exclude=reversion.revision --exclude=captcha.captchastore
--exclude=sessions.session
So I can loaddata now.
